1031 exchange with 100% seller financing

Kevin Eisentrout
  • Investor
  • Morgantown, WV
Posted

I am trying to organize the purchase of an apartment building from a colleague. The building has doubled in value since he has owned it, and he does not want to take the huge tax hit from selling, but he does not want to 1031 exchange into another building. I’ve researched doing a 1031 exchange and converting to a note using seller financing, but many of the articles only discuss doing a portion of the purchase as seller financing. Is it possible/how difficult would it be for him to 100% seller finance the property to me and take ownership of the note using a 1031 exchange. Does anyone have any qualified intermediary’s to recommend? How much does a QI typically charge for this type of transaction?
